Due to conditions in Germany no longer allow transport and delivery of next of kin parcels, those still in hands of GPO would be handed back to Red Cross and returned to sender.

A map of Stalag Luft 7 drawn by D G Gray and dated December 1944. It shows a compound of huts, one of tents and one under construction. The Russians have a separate, smaller compound as do the Germans.
Front quarter view from above of an Avro Lincoln on taxiway. In the background a dispersal pan and runway caravan. On the reverse 'Lincoln at Tengah of No 1 Bomber Squadron Singapore, by courtesy of D G Howell, signed D G Howell 5 MU'.
Request that Harold Wakefield report to the Leicester recruiting centre on 9 January 1942. Gives instructions on what to bring and advises that he might not be required for immediate service.
